Abstract
The magnetic dipole radiative decay of a glueball is considered within the MIT bag model. The resultant width, due to gluonic coupling to quarks, is sizable. In addition to -glueball mixing, other contributions are found to be significant. We comment that, for magnetic dipole transitions, the radiative widths of glueballs can be expected to be larger than those of radially excited mesons, due to wave-function-orthogonality effects in the latter case.
